Abstract

Modern education in the era of Society 5.0 provides broad access for all segments of society to educational content. However, providing a learning experience for the Arabic language within the concept of lifelong learning, to understand and delve into the teachings of the Quran as a guide for life, a source of knowledge, and a reference on the teachings of Islam, has not been fully realized and felt by all segments of society. The researcher found that the content of Arabic language education on the website "Bayyinah Dream" serves as an alternative source that can meet the community's needs for learning Arabic for specific purposes, utilizing the concept of lifelong learning and maximizing the use of technology in the learning process. As for the method of collecting his data using observation and documentation. This study aims to explore the Arabic language education content on the "Bayyinah Dream" website as an alternative source to meet community needs. The study describes the program structure, materials, teaching methods, and evaluates its contribution to Arabic language education in Society 5.0. The findings highlight the engaging nature of the program, its alignment with the Quran as a life guide, and the structured arrangement of materials. The content on "Bayyinah Dream" facilitates enjoyable and lifelong learning experiences.
